Acceptance rate & Admissions

Texas A&M International University has an acceptance rate of 44% and is among the top 1% of the most difficult universities to gain admission to in the United States. The university reports the admission statistics without distinguishing between local and international students.

Total Men Women
Acceptance Rate 44% 44% 44%
Applicants 8,499 3,449 5,050
Admissions 3,771 1,463 2,308
Freshmen enrolled full time 1,345 547 798

Texas A&M International University majors

Texas A&M International University has granted 1,362 bachelor's degrees across 24 programs, 634 master's across 21 programs, and 6 doctorate degrees across 1 programs. Below is a table with majors that lead to degrees at Texas A&M International University.

Henry Cuellar

1. Henry Cuellar

1955-. (aged 71)
lawyer politician
Enrique Roberto "Henry" Cuellar is an American politician and attorney serving as the U.S. representative for Texas's 28th congressional district since 2005. He is a member of the Democratic Party, and his district spans from the Rio Grande toward the suburbs of San Antonio.
